Metaphor and Literalism in Buddhism: The Doctrinal History of Nirvana - Routledge Critical Studies in Buddhism - Oxford Centre for Buddhist Studies 1st edition

Soonil Hwang studies the doctrinal development of nirvana in the Pali Nikaaya and subsequent tradition and compares it with the Chinese aagama and its traditional interpretation.
